Forecast Snow Stability: Little change expected. The thawing and stable snow cover will be very limited, with the few remaining snow patches lingering in high North to East aspects above 700 metres. The mountains will be mostly bare and snow patches will be avoidable. The avalanche hazard will be Low.

Snowpack Structure

Forecast Weather Influences: Summit cloud with patchy rain and drizzle will persist throughout the period. Moderate South-South-West winds will steadily freshen through the day and the freezing level will remain above the highest summits. Observed Weather Influences: A day of summit cloud with persistent light rain and drizzle at all elevations, becoming patchy in the afternoon with some bright spells. There was a fresh West-South-West wind and the freezing level stayed above the summits. ObservedSnowStability: The thawing and stable snow cover is now very limited with the few remaining snow patches lingering on high North to East aspects above 700 metres. The mountains are mostly bare. The avalanche hazard is Low.
